  • Global glacier mass changes from 1850 to 2012 as reconstructed from a multivariate regression analysis. The table provides reconstructed mass changes and related error bars (95% confidence levels) for all as well as for the individual forcings. Supplementary data table with the results from Zemp, M. and Marzeion, B. (2021): Dwindling relevance of large volcanic eruptions for global glacier changes in the Anthropocene. Geophysical Research Letters, 48, e2021GL092964. https://doi. org/10.1029/2021GL092964
